What is renewable energy?

Renewable energy is a treasure that never runs out, unlike the rum on our treasure ship!

It’s energy obtained from nature, replenished faster than we can use it.

Let me tell you about the main types:

  • Solar power: It uses the power of the sun, just like me sunbathing on the deck!
  • Wind power: It captures the wind, just like our sails catching the breeze.
  • Hydropower: It uses the power of rapids and waterfalls, like riding the rough seas.
  • Geothermal power: It uses the heat from underground, like striking a treasure trove.
  • Biomass: It gets energy by burning plant and animal waste, like cooking on board.

Why is it important?

Renewable energy is essential for our future voyages!

Why? Simple:

  1. Unlike buried treasure, it never runs out.
  2. It doesn’t emit harmful gases, keeping the sea and sky clean.
  3. It makes us less dependent on other countries for energy, like free pirates!

Japan’s challenge

Look, Japan has also embarked on the adventure of renewable energy!

They’ve set a goal to make 36-38% of their electricity renewable by 2030.

Obstacles ahead

But not everything is smooth sailing.

There are some tough problems with renewable energy:

  • Reliability: The wind doesn’t always blow, and the sun doesn’t always shine. It’s like the fickle sea.
  • Storage: We need better ways to store energy, like hiding treasure.
  • Cost: It can still be expensive, but in the long run, it should pay off.
